Android室数据库 – 未解决的参考@Entity和其他注释
我在我的应用程序中使用Android Room Persistence库(v.1.0.0-alpha1)。 虽然它工作正常,当我在Android Studio中打开模型类(Kotlin Data类)时,它会显示所有用于Room数据库(如@Entity , @ColumnInfo等)的注释的未解析引用。我尝试将版本库更改为1.0.0 -alpha5但结果是一样的。
在林特检查显示删除不推荐使用的符号导入所有导入的注释.AS以前没有显示此错误。
我该如何解决这个问题
编辑以下是我在build.gradle中添加的导入
compile "android.arch.persistence.room:runtime:1.0.0-alpha5" compile "android.arch.persistence.room:rxjava2:1.0.0-alpha5" annotationProcessor "android.arch.persistence.room:compiler:1.0.0-alpha5" kapt "android.arch.persistence.room:compiler:1.0.0-alpha5"
- 使用kapt Android Studio进行注释处理
- 第一个参数是带有一个方法的类时,不能用lambda替换SAM构造函数
- 如何在Android中获取ObservableField的值
- Android 4.4中的自定义视图构造函数在Kotlin上崩溃,如何修复?
- 内联setter或不在Kotlin中创建未使用的setter?
- Kotlin减少功能为2d列表不起作用
- 将textView替换为NumberPicker – Android
- Kotlin Android视图绑定:findViewById vs Butterknife vs Kotlin Android扩展
- Dagger2 @Nullable注释与Kotlin
- Android Kotlin – 无法调用onNavigationItemSelected方法
- 我的模型更改时如何重绘Anko frameLayout?
- 包含Android扩展的Kotlin类不是建立在随后的构建上的
- 监听器绑定; 找不到Setter
- Dagger2和Kotlin运行失败的原因是:app:compileDebugKotlinAfterJava